When DIY Fixes Are Safe
If you’re comfortable working with electronics, certain minor repairs can be done at home with minimal risk. Here are some examples:
1. Cleaning Your Device
- Dust buildup can cause overheating and slow performance. Using compressed air or a microfiber cloth can safely clean vents, keyboards, and ports.
- Alcohol wipes can remove dirt and fingerprints from screens and cases.
2. Battery & Charging Issues
- If your device isn’t charging, try using a different cable, charger, or outlet.
- Cleaning the charging port with a toothpick or compressed air can remove debris blocking the connection.
3. Software Fixes
- Restarting your device can resolve many common glitches.
- Updating software and drivers can improve performance and fix bugs.
- Factory resets can restore devices experiencing persistent software issues (ensure you back up data first!).
When to Seek Professional Help
Some repairs require specialized tools, technical knowledge, and experience. Attempting them yourself may cause more harm than good. Here are situations where you should visit Techmate for professional repair services:
1. Cracked or Broken Screens
- Replacing a smartphone or laptop screen requires precision and the right tools.
- DIY attempts can lead to further damage, loss of touch functionality, or even injury from broken glass.
2. Water Damage
- DIY methods like using rice don’t effectively fix water-damaged devices.
- Professional technicians use ultrasonic cleaning and specialized tools to repair water-exposed components.
3. Battery Replacements
- Many modern devices have non-removable batteries that require expert disassembly.
- Improper removal can damage internal components or even cause battery swelling and explosions.
4. Hardware Failures
- Issues with internal components like the motherboard, hard drive, or RAM require professional diagnostics and replacement.
